It calculates how many zombies to spawn based on the current wave number and the number of active players in the server.
Old scripts often spawn hundreds of NPCs at once, causing massive frame rate drops. A "new" template should use object pooling or distance-based spawning to keep the game running smoothly even during intense waves. 2. Customization Hooks

"Zombie Attack Uncopylocked New" appears to refer to a freshly released or updated uncopylocked version of a "Zombie Attack" game—commonly understood in user-generated gaming communities (like Roblox) as a shareable, editable game file where the original creator has allowed others to copy, modify, and reuse the map, scripts, or assets. This essay explains what such a release means, its appeal, typical features, community implications, and best practices for using or creating an uncopylocked zombie-attack game.
